What is Genuine Ambient Lighting Activation?
Genuine ambient lighting activation, as performed by specialists like 'Today's Car' in Jeonju, South Korea, involves utilizing genuine parts or integrating with the vehicle's existing factory system. This allows you to control the ambient light's color and brightness directly through the original navigation screen, just as if it were a factory-installed feature. The system supports 64 full-color options and can be easily managed via the car's touch screen or control dials. This isn't just about adding lights; it's about elevating the vehicle's perceived luxury and the overall user experience, creating a personalized mood lighting effect.

Installation Process and Quality Features
Specialist installers prioritize quality and durability. They use KC-certified, high-grade domestic products that ensure consistent brightness, even in daylight, and offer reliable long-term performance. Beyond simple color changes, advanced features often include welcome/goodbye sequences upon starting or turning off the engine, door-open warning light synchronization, and automatic brightness adjustment for day and night. Some systems even offer music synchronization and gradient effects for a truly customized driving environment. The installation itself is meticulous. Using ultrasonic welding to secure sound-absorbing materials prevents rattles from wiring vibrations, ensuring a factory-like finish. Individual connectors for each lighting zone and the application of sound-dampening tape along wiring harnesses further minimize noise. Custom-fit acrylic light guides for the Carnival KA4 ensure uniform light distribution from any angle.
Installation process:
- Careful disassembly of interior trim panels to access wiring routes.
- Installation of custom-fit light guides along dashboard and door panels.
- Wiring the LED modules, ensuring secure connections and routing to prevent noise.
- Integration with the vehicle's infotainment system for control via the factory screen.
- Reassembly of trim panels, ensuring a factory-perfect fit and finish.
The estimated cost for this type of ambient lighting retrofit in South Korea can range from approximately 500,000 to 1,000,000 KRW, which translates to roughly $370 to $740 USD, depending on the complexity and specific features chosen. While this is a significant investment, the enhanced aesthetics and personalized cabin experience often make it a worthwhile upgrade for owners looking to differentiate their Kia Carnival KA4.

Q. What is the difference between OEM and aftermarket ambient lighting for a Kia Carnival KA4?
OEM (or genuine activation) uses factory-compatible parts and integrates seamlessly with the car's infotainment system for control, offering a factory-installed look and feel. Aftermarket kits are typically less expensive but may require separate controllers and might not offer the same level of integration or aesthetic finish.
